Features¶
Aggregation of input data for any user-defined regions provided as a shapefile
Automation of the pre-processing to document assumptions and avoid human errors
Cleaning of raw input data and creation of model-independent intermediate files
Adaptation to the intermediate files to the models urbs and evrys as of version 1.0.1
Applications¶
This code is useful if:
You want to create different models using the same input database, but different model regions
You want to harmonize the assumptions used in different model frameworks (for comparison and/or linking)
You want to generate many models in a short amount of time with fewer human errors
